This was a fun. The worm was barely recognizable as a worm. It vaguely looked like a proglottid, but the specimen was badly degraded. Clearing the tissue with some lactophenol exposed the genus-level ID. Taenia eggs in utero. Hooklets visible even!

Fun treat today in the lab. A bunch of ticks from Ohio, each smaller than a poppy seed. Looks like a skydiving formation ๐.
โ๏ธ No eyes
โ๏ธ Long mouthparts
โ๏ธ Inverted anal groove
โ๏ธ 6 legs.
How would you report?
